Claustrophobia is a blue common enchantment card from the 2015 Magic Origins set, identified by the set code ORI and card number 50. As an Aura enchantment, this card requires a creature to enchant and imposes a significant restriction on its controller. Upon entering the battlefield, the enchantment forces the targeted creature to tap, immediately neutralizing its ability to attack or use activated abilities that require tapping. Beyond that initial disruption, Claustrophobia ensures the creature remains stuck in place by preventing it from untapping during its controller’s untap step. This persistent hold makes it a valuable tool for players seeking to disrupt enemy strategies and maintain board control.
